Overview: TB62209F Preliminary TOSHIBA BiCD Processor IC Silicon Monolithic TB62209F Stepping Motor Driver IC Using PWM Chopper Type The TB62209F is a stepping motor driver driven by chopper micro-step pseudo sine wave. The TB62209F integrates a decoder for CLK input in micro steps as a system to facilitate driving a two-phase stepping motor using micro-step pseudo sine waves. Micro-step pseudo sine waves are optimal for driving stepping motors with low-torque ripples and at low oscillation. Thus, the TB62209F can easily drive stepping motors with low-torque ripples and at high efficiency. Also, TB62209F consists output steps by DMOS (Power MOS Weight: g (typ.) FET), and that makes possible to control the output power dissipation much lower than ordinary IC with bipolar transistor output. The IC supports Mixed Decay mode for switching the attenuation ratio at chopping. The switching time for the attenuation ratio can be switched in four stages according to the load.
